Two Pieces of Northeastern U.S. Stoneware, circa 1870, a two-gallon jug with stylized cobalt foliate design, stamped "FRANK B NORTON / WORCESTER MASS", paired with a one-gallon jug with stylized foliate design, Stamped "WHITE'S UTICA". Norton jug with two shallow spout chips, some light fry to cobalt, a small iron ping near base. White's Utica jug in essentially as-made condition with some fry to cobalt and a small in-the-firing chip to shoulder.
